3. The “Three‑Step Warm‑Shift” Routine
Every morning, spend 5 minutes on this ritual. It’s short enough to stick, powerful enough to rewire habits.
1. Mirror Check‑In – Look at yourself and silently note any SELF‑SATISFIED thoughts. Replace them with a mantra: “My worth grows when I lift others.” 2. Warm Greeting Practice – Stand in front of a mirror, smile, and say a warm greeting to an imagined stranger: “Hey there! I’m glad you’re here.” Feel the openness radiate. 3. Curiosity‑Swap – Write down one question you usually would ask out of nosiness (e.g., “How much do you earn?”). Then rewrite it as a WARM & WELCOMING version: “What’s something exciting you’re working on right now?” Notice the shift from invasive to inviting.
Do this daily for a week and watch the mental chatter change.
4. Real‑World Application: Turning Meetings into Warm‑Spaces
Meetings are fertile ground for both SELF‑SATISFIED brag‑fest and BUSYBODY gossip. Here’s a quick cheat‑sheet to keep the vibe WARM & WELCOMING:
Start with a gratitude round – each person shares one thing they appreciate about a colleague. This instantly dilutes arrogance. - Ask “What’s your win?” instead of “What did you do?” – reframes the conversation from what you did (potentially bragging) to what you’re proud of (shared celebration). - Set a “no‑interrogation” rule – if a question feels like a BUSYBODY probe, replace it with an open‑ended invitation: “Tell us about a challenge you’re tackling.”
By the end of the meeting, participants will feel invited, not invaded, and the collective energy shifts toward collaboration.

6. Homework: The Warm‑Audit Challenge
1. Pick a day this week where you anticipate interacting with at least three people (work, coffee shop, family). 2. Before each interaction, pause and ask: - Am I feeling SELF‑SATISFIED? If yes, consciously shift to a WARM & WELCOMING greeting. - Do I have a BUSYBODY impulse? If yes, reframe the question using the Curiosity‑Swap technique. 3. After each encounter, jot down: - How you felt before and after. - Any noticeable change in the other person’s response.
Review your notes on Sunday. You’ll likely see a pattern: the more you practice WARM & WELCOMING, the less space there is for SELF‑SATISFIED or BUSYBODY habits.
